Skills frameworks are structured methodologies that transform how you interact with AI. Unlike ad-hoc prompting, frameworks provide systematic approaches that consistently yield superior results across similar tasks. Think of them as design patterns for AI interaction—battle-tested templates that encapsulate best practices and proven techniques.
Each framework addresses a specific category of challenges: reasoning through complex problems, writing clean code, managing multi-step workflows, or integrating external data sources. Rather than treating every conversation as a unique challenge, frameworks give you reusable structures that can be adapted and composed to tackle increasingly sophisticated use cases.
